Lot Description
An early twentieth century silver stamp case modelled as a book with pivoting compartment and Penny Red postage stamp, the stamp case suspended on beaded chain. Stamp case hallmarked Crisford & Norris Ltd, Birmingham 1915. Height of stamp case measuring 2.8 cm.

Condition Report
The lot displays general surface scratches, marks and wear commensurate with the age and use. Heavy tarnishing visible and would benefit from a clean and polish. Penny Red has postal franking and appears worn. Chain appears unmarked, bolt ring stamped 925. Hallmarks to case clear and legible.
